Written by the British author Hugh Lofting, is the first of his Doctor Dolittle books, a series of children's novels about a man who learns to talk to animals and becomes their champion around the world. In this book, we are told how Dr John Dolittle came to learn the language of animals, and become and animal doctor. His journey to Africa to treat the sick Monkeys, and his return back to England. Journey back to the magical land of Oz with L. Frank Baum’s "Dorothy and the Wizard of Oz." When an earthquake transports Dorothy, her cat, and her cousins to the strange land of the Mangaboos, they reunite with the beloved Wizard. Together, they navigate through wondrous kingdoms filled with vegetable people, invisible creatures, and formidable challenges. Rich with imagination and adventure, this enchanting tale celebrates friendship, bravery, and the endless wonders of Baum’s extraordinary world.Zum Buch
